City Files Suit Against USA Metal

The city of Siloam Springs is taking a recycling company to court hoping to get the operation out of the city.    

The suit was filed Monday, seeking an injunction to stop USA Metal Recycling from operating at its facility on Kenwood Street.

The city says the business was operating without the appropriate business license for the past few years.

In April, the business volunteered to relocate with a city set deadline of October 6th.

On September 25th, the business requested an extension that was denied by the city because they weren't making a "good faith reasonable effort to relocate."
